Hamill, Crouch and Avlon: Deadline Artists

New York City’s NY1 cable channel on Tuesday, Sept. 27, broadcast a roundtable on NSNC member John Avlon’s new anthology Deadline Artists. It was moderated by Avlon’s co-editor Errol Louis, who works for NY1 as host of Inside City Hall. At the table were Louis, Avlon, Stanley Crouch and Pete Hamill. Hamill is the 2005…

NSNC Honored at Indiana University

Ernie Pyle’s Distinguished Alumni Award was awarded last weekend by the Indiana University School of Journalism, which was celebrating its centennial. The university created a Hall of Fame with 15 inductees, 10 posthumous and five living. Since Ernie has no living relatives, they asked Mike Leonard to accept on behalf of the National Society of Newspaper…

iPad App to feature Herb Caen’s Best Columns

The San Francisco Chronicle’s Pulitzer Prize winning columnist Herb Caen will  be showcased in multimedia presentations for Apple iPad users, according to MarketWire.  Caen’s classic stories will be narrated by some of his closest friends and video will include vintage photos and film footage of San Francisco and the Bay Area notables that Caen wrote about…
